Below are the tables that show how much weight a dog needs to successfully pull in order to qualify
for a WPD or WPDX leg. For a WWPD leg, all dogs must pull 12 times it's body weight. For a WWPDX leg, the multiplier changes.
For dogs at 80 pounds or less, they must pull 23 times their body weight. For dogs 81-100 pounds, they must pull 21 times thier body weight.
For dogs from 101-120 pounds, it is 19 times their body weight.
